Filter Type and Quality

The filter type and quality are crucial considerations when buying a portable air purifier. The most common types of filters used in portable air purifiers are HEPA (High Efficiency Particulate Air) filters, activated carbon filters, and pre-filters. HEPA filters are considered the gold standard, as they can capture 99.97% of particles as small as 0.3 microns, including dust, pollen, and other allergens. Activated carbon filters, on the other hand, are effective in removing gases, odors, and volatile organic compounds (VOCs). Pre-filters are designed to capture larger particles, such as hair and dust, and help extend the life of the main filter. When evaluating filter quality, look for devices with HEPA filters that have a high CADR (Clean Air Delivery Rate) rating, which measures the filter’s ability to remove pollutants.

Coverage Area and CADR

Another critical factor to consider when buying a portable air purifier is its coverage area and CADR. The coverage area refers to the size of the room or space that the device can effectively clean, while CADR measures the filter’s ability to remove pollutants. A higher CADR rating indicates that the device can remove more pollutants and clean the air faster. When selecting a portable air purifier, consider the size of the room where it will be used and choose a device with a coverage area that matches or exceeds that space. For example, a device with a coverage area of 200 square feet is suitable for small rooms, while a device with a coverage area of 500 square feet is better suited for larger rooms.

How do portable air purifiers work?

Portable air purifiers work by using a combination of filters and technologies to remove pollutants and particles from the air. The most common type of filter used in portable air purifiers is a HEPA (High Efficiency Particulate Air) filter, which can capture up to 99.97% of particles as small as 0.3 microns. This includes dust, pollen, and other allergens that can exacerbate respiratory issues. Some portable air purifiers also use additional technologies, such as activated carbon filters or UV light, to remove gases, odors, and bacteria from the air.

The process of air purification is relatively simple. The device draws in air from the surrounding environment, which is then passed through one or more filters. The filtered air is then released back into the environment, leaving the air clean and fresh. Many portable air purifiers also come with features like air quality sensors and adjustable fan speeds, which allow you to customize the device to your specific needs. For example, some devices may have an automatic mode that adjusts the fan speed based on the air quality, while others may have a turbo mode for quickly cleaning the air in a small space.

Can portable air purifiers remove odor and smoke?

Yes, many portable air purifiers are capable of removing odor and smoke from the air. These devices often use a combination of filters, including activated carbon filters, which are designed to capture gases and odors. Activated carbon is a highly effective material for removing odors and smoke, as it has a large surface area that allows it to trap and neutralize pollutants. Some portable air purifiers also use additional technologies, such as UV light or ionizers, to remove bacteria and other microorganisms that can cause odors.

The effectiveness of a portable air purifier at removing odor and smoke will depend on the specific device and the severity of the odor or smoke. However, many devices have been shown to be highly effective at removing these pollutants. How often should I replace the filter in my portable air purifier?

The frequency with which you should replace the filter in your portable air purifier will depend on the specific device and how often you use it. Most manufacturers recommend replacing the filter every 6-12 months, but this can vary depending on the device’s usage and the air quality in your environment. For example, if you use your portable air purifier in a heavily polluted area or if you have pets that shed heavily, you may need to replace the filter more frequently.

It’s also important to check the device’s filter indicator, which will typically alert you when the filter needs to be replaced. A worn-out filter can reduce the device’s effectiveness and even release captured pollutants back into the air.
